
Robbert Dijkgraaf says he will propose legislation in March
Dutch science minister Robbert Dijkgraaf has conceded that the Netherlands has reached full capacity in terms of the number of international students its universities can take on, but he says he needs more time to propose a solution.
During a lively debate in parliament on 31 January, the minister, who in previous debates on the matter has emphasised the importance of internationalisation, agreed that legislation was required to control the number of international students in the country.
